Transaction b31f76694e0878591a1b26f29a2175161b38604e1df659fc50b76de39d9e9c4a
1 Input
1 Output
-
b31f76694e0878591a1b26f29a2175161b38604e1df659fc50b76de39d9e9c4a:0
- value
- 4936000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2b59858f343acc5baf3a168b212c84b10eec76a3f9e307d7669e89f26c08feb6
- address
- bc1p9dvctre58tx9hte6z69jztyyky8wca4rl83s04mxn6ylymqgl6mq5uxhsz